    The MBI isn't so bad. There's a lot of character, yes, but character's don't know everything about everyone else, which means you don't have to have read everything to participate. Usually, when you create a character, you have a look through the characters of the more active players (or just talk to the other players) and find characters who yours might interact with. That limits the amount to read through considerably.

     

    What I'd recommend the MBI for in particular is for practicing to writing well formed characters - a character application is usually something like 1000-3000 words (people usually write about 1000 words for their first one, but write more when they've been around for a bit), and this encompasses their history, personality, and an RP sample. We like to make sure characters make sense, that their backstory is plausible, and that character traits that'd depend on their history are properly justified.
